What is Salicylic Acid?
Salicylic acid is a lipophilic monohydroxybenzoic acid that is derived from willow bark. It is a type of beta-hydroxy acid, which means that it is oil-soluble and can penetrate deep into the pores. Salicylic acid is also known as a keratolytic agent, which means that it helps to exfoliate dead skin cells.

Benefits of Salicylic Acid
Salicylic acid has several benefits for the skin. It can help to unclog pores, which makes it an effective treatment for acne-prone skin. It also has exfoliating properties, which can help to improve the texture and tone of the skin. Salicylic acid can also help to minimize the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.

How to Use Salicylic Acid
Salicylic acid is generally safe for use in skincare products, but it is important to use it correctly. It is typically found in concentrations of 2% or lower in over-the-counter products. If you have sensitive skin, it is best to start with a lower concentration and gradually increase it over time. Salicylic acid can be found in many different types of skincare products, including cleansers, toners, serums, and spot treatments.

Precautions When Using Salicylic Acid
While salicylic acid is generally safe for use in skincare products, there are some precautions that you should take. It is important to avoid using salicylic acid in high concentrations, as this can lead to skin irritation and dryness. If you experience redness, itching, or burning after using a product that contains salicylic acid, it is best to discontinue use and consult a dermatologist.
